The St. Brendan parish held its final Sunday mass before it merges with St. Christine and St. Matthias churches to become the St. Mary Magdalene parish due to declined attendance.
Bishop David J. Bonnar of the Catholic Diocese of Youngstown presided over the mass with a focus on grace and hope.
